Using the php-dfa-sensitive Library for Sensitive Word Detection in PHP Projects
This article explains how to install the php-dfa-sensitive Composer package, create a SensitiveWords service in a Laravel‑style PHP application, and use its static methods to detect, replace, mark, or retrieve illegal words from user‑generated content.
The article introduces a PHP extension called php-dfa-sensitive , which provides DFA‑based sensitive‑word filtering capabilities for applications that need to validate user signatures or messages.
Installation is performed via Composer:
composer require lustre/php-dfa-sensitiveAfter installing, a new service class SensitiveWords should be placed under the app/Services directory. The class encapsulates a singleton instance of DfaFilter\SensitiveHelper and loads default dictionaries located in storage/dict (e.g., bk.txt , fd.txt , ms.txt , etc.).
<?php
namespace App\Services;
use DfaFilter\SensitiveHelper;
class SensitiveWords {
protected static $handle = null;
private function __construct() {}
private function __clone() {}
public static function getInstance($word_path = []) {
if (!self::$handle) {
$default_path = [
storage_path('dict/bk.txt'),
storage_path('dict/fd.txt'),
storage_path('dict/ms.txt'),
storage_path('dict/qt.txt'),
storage_path('dict/sq.txt'),
storage_path('dict/tf.txt'),
];
$paths = array_merge($default_path, $word_path);
self::$handle = SensitiveHelper::init();
if (!empty($paths)) {
foreach ($paths as $path) {
self::$handle->setTreeByFile($path);
}
}
}
return self::$handle;
}
public static function isLegal($content) {
return self::getInstance()->islegal($content);
}
public static function replace($content, $replace_char = '', $repeat = false, $match_type = 1) {
return self::getInstance()->replace($content, $replace_char, $repeat, $match_type);
}
public static function mark($content, $start_tag, $end_tag, $match_type = 1) {
return self::getInstance()->mark($content, $start_tag, $end_tag, $match_type);
}
public static function getBadWord($content, $match_type = 1, $word_num = 0) {
return self::getInstance()->getBadWord($content, $match_type, $word_num);
}
}In application code you can now call the static methods, for example to retrieve any illegal words:
$bad_word = SensitiveWords::getBadWord($content);
if (!empty($bad_word)) {
throw new \Exception('包含敏感词:' . current($bad_word));
